Al Majaz 3
Auto Accessories Store Installation of all types of thermal insulation concealed paint protection Installing screens - headphones - recorders Auto spare parts trading Seat upholstery Installing floors and leather of all colors
Accessories
Courts
Other
Traffic & licensing
Pharmacies
Complexes